I have a list of daily stock returns for each stock on the S&P 500. The returns are formatted so that each stock is grouped together like this:
1/1/2013 AAPL .005%
1/2/2013 AAPL -.1%
....
1/1/2013 GOOG .5%
1/2/2013 GOOG .25%
How would I sort this so that the each stock can be a column name and have its returns below it?

>> data=readtable('jack.dat','format','%{MM/dd/yyyy}D %s %f%%')
data =
Var1 Var2 Var3
__________ ______ _____
01/01/2013 'AAPL' 0.005
01/02/2013 'AAPL' -0.1
01/01/2013 'GOOG' 0.5
01/02/2013 'GOOG' 0.25
>> [u,~,ic]=unique(data.Var2);
>> stks=table(data.Var1(ic==1)); % get the dates first; must all be same
>> for i=1:length(u) % get each individual stock
stks(:,i+1)=table(data.Var3(ic==i));end
>> stks.Properties.VariableNames=[{'Date'}, u.'] % add useful names
stks =
Date AAPL GOOG
__________ _____ ____
01/01/2013 0.005 0.5
01/02/2013 -0.1 0.25
>> clear data % done with it...
Above does assume that every stock has the identical timestamp; any missing will cause failure.

Could you elaborate more on the preprocessing? I'm struggeling with the same issue with the same three columns (date, ticker and return).
All companies/tickers will have different timestamps as we are looking into IPOs and therefore they will start at different times.

Specific code would depend greatly on how you have the data available to start from and whether you know the overall first/last dates a priori or have to determine that from a collection of files as well.
Probably the simplest would be to first create a datetime array of the overall length from first to last and use it to build the date column in the output table. Then, when you read each dataset, convert its date field to datetime and use logical indexing to insert into the proper locations in the table with a missing value indicator elsewhere.
